This is the most fascinating laser diode I've ever seen. This is the heart of the famous SDL -5762 MOPA LASER that were last made in 99' when JDS Uniphase bought the co.. MOPA stands for ( Master Oscillator Power Amplifier). and this one is a combination on one chip of the Amplifier and seed laser to produce 1/2 watt of single mode 670nm laser light as seen in my tests of the chip. You will need 2 drivers to power it. There are 3 connections on the back of the chip. One for the seed laser anode @ 150ma's, one for the amplifier anode @ 2.0 Amps, and one for the 2 cathodes tied together from both drivers. You will need to add your own cooling via tec or coolant pump. I used a modified High Heatload pkg. from a dead 1.2 watt laser w/tec intact.
